diff options
-rw-r--r-- | cmake/libutils.cmake |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/cmake/libutils.cmake b/cmake/libutils.cmake index 25fef77b472..faa46f5eeb6 100644 --- a/cmake/libutils.cmake +++ b/cmake/libutils.cmake @@ -207,10 +207,9 @@ MACRO(MERGE_STATIC_LIBS TARGET OUTPUT_NAME LIBS_TO_MERGE) SET(SCRIPT_CONTENTS "CREATE $<TARGET_FILE:${TARGET}>\n") FOREACH(LIB ${STATIC_LIBS}) - STRING(APPEND SCRIPT_CONTENTS "ADDLIB ${LIB}\n") + SET(SCRIPT_CONTENTS "${SCRIPT_CONTENTS}\nADDLIB ${LIB}\n") ENDFOREACH() - STRING(APPEND SCRIPT_CONTENTS "SAVE\nEND\n") - FILE(WRITE ${MRI_SCRIPT_TPL} "${SCRIPT_CONTENTS}") + FILE(WRITE ${MRI_SCRIPT_TPL} "${SCRIPT_CONTENTS}\nSAVE\nEND\n") FILE(GENERATE OUTPUT ${MRI_SCRIPT} INPUT ${MRI_SCRIPT_TPL}) ADD_CUSTOM_COMMAND(TARGET ${TARGET} POST_BUILD |